What are the top historical places and other sights to visit in South of Market?
South of Market is notable for landmarks like Ferry Building, Bay Bridge and San Francisco Mint. Known for its museums and art, cultural venues include SOMA Pilipinas, San Francisco Museum of Modern Art and Market Street Railway Museum. Other popular sights include Oracle Park and Chase Center.

What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
They are quite similar. “Historic hotel” is a term often used in the US, whereas “heritage hotel” is common in Asia and Europe. Historic hotels tend to focus on the physical building and architecture. Heritage hotels draw their meaning mainly from the cultural value and how it inspired the surrounding community.
